The question is, do you really care enough to protect your maps so that "map stealers" can erase your name and put their name on it? If you want to keep it that way, then you might as well not release your map, because no protection is 100% safe. However, there is a program that apparantly can unprotect Proedit maps. Starforge is probably the same way, and Guedit is definately unprotectable.
Now if you just want to keep your version from newbies opening up the map, changing something, then saving, forcing everyone to download a new version, go with whatever is easiest. These alleged "map stealers" must be crazy to try and steal maps because most good maps are made on forums, and the original copy would probably spread faster than the modified copy...
All that being said, Proedit is very easy to protect with, but uBeR@TiOn is a better protection.
To protect in uBeR@TiOn, run it, open the map (top left big button) in your starcraft maps folder (generally C:\Program Files\Starcraft\Maps). Then make sure you save as (top right big button) and save it as a different map name. Then, use the uBeR@Te button under the Open button that says protection right above it.
